ExpressionService
Пространство имен: PP.Ufe;
Иерархия наследования
Object
PPService
ExpressionService
Описание
Класс ExpressionService предназначен
для работы с сервисом выражений экспресс-отчета.
Синтаксис
PP.initClass(PP.Ufe.ExpressionService, [PP.Mb.PPService,
PP.Mb.PPSrvMixin], "PP.Ufe.ExpressionService");
Конструктор
| |
Имя конструктора |
Краткое описание |
 |
ExpressionService |
Конструктор ExpressionService
создает экземпляр класса ExpressionService. |
Методы
| |
Имя метода |
Краткое описание |
 |
beginBatch |
Метод beginBatch включает
пакетный режим отправки запросов. |
 |
endBatch |
Метод endBatch отключает
пакетный режим отправки запросов и выполняет отправку сформированного
пакета. |
 |
getIsBatchMode |
Метод getIsBatchMode
возвращает признак включения пакетного режима отправки запросов. |
 |
getUfeFunctions |
Метод getUfeFunctions
возвращает дерево функций для редактора выражений. |
 |
send |
Метод send отправляет
запрос сервису выражений. |
 |
setExpression |
Метод setExpression
отправляет запрос на добавление термов для выражения. |
События
| |
Имя события |
Краткое описание |
 |
GetTerms |
Событие GetTerms наступает
после успешного получения термов для добавления в выражение. |
 |
GetTermsErr |
Событие GetTermsErr
наступает после получения термов с ошибками для добавления в выражение. |
Свойства, унаследованные от класса PPService
| |
Имя свойства |
Краткое описание |
 |
PPServiceUrl |
Свойство PPServiceUrl устнавливает
URL-адрес обработчика запросов веб-сервиса. |
Методы, унаследованные от класса PPService
| |
Имя метода |
Краткое описание |
 |
addCallbackToLastRqt |
Метод addCallbackToLastRqt
добавляет обработчик к последнему в очереди запросу. |
 |
beginSyncXHR |
Метод beginSyncXHR
включает режим синхронных запросов для экземпляра класса PPService. |
 |
clearRequests |
Метод clearRequests очищает
список запросов из очереди а также удаляет текущий запрос. |
 |
endSyncXHR |
Метод endSyncXHR отключает
режим синхронных запросов для экземпляра класса PPService. |
 |
getCurrentRequest |
Метод getCurrentRequest
возвращает текущий запрос сервисов. |
 |
sendRequest |
Метод sendRequest отправляет запрос веб-сервису. |
События, унаследованные от класса PPService
| |
Имя события |
Краткое описание |
 |
EndRequest |
Событие EndRequest
наступает при окончании соединения с репозиторием. |
 |
Error |
Событие Error наступает,
если во время соединения с репозиторием произошла ошибка. |
 |
Executed |
Событие Executed наступает
после выполнения запроса к серверу. |
 |
StartRequest |
Событие StartRequest
наступает в начале выполнения запроса к репозиторию. |
Свойства, унаследованные от класса Object
| |
Имя свойства |
Краткое описание |
 |
Data |
Свойство Data ассоциирует
произвольный объект с данным компонентом. |
 |
Id |
Свойство Id устанавливает
идентификатор компонента. |
 |
Settings |
Свойство Settings задает
параметры компонента. |
Методы, унаследованные от класса Object
| |
Имя метода |
Краткое описание |
 |
clone |
Метод clone создает
копию объекта. Не реализован в PP.Ui.Control. |
 |
dispose |
Метод dispose уничтожает
компонент. |
 |
getTypeName |
Метод getTypeName возвращает
имя типа объекта без пространства имён, к которому он принадлежит. |
См. также:
PP.Ufe